About the university
The University of Notre Dame Australia is a private Catholic University with over 1,000 permanent staff providing an exceptional educational experience to over 12,000 students across our Fremantle, Broome, and Sydney campuses, as well as clinical schools in Victoria and New South Wales.   About the role

You will be responsible for supporting Allied Health and Nursing/Midwifery students who are on placement with Majarlin and based in Kununurra. In doing so, they will engage in a wide variety of student support, facilities management, and general administrative duties. This role will also provide quality support to the Majarlin's Program Manager (based in Sydney), Administration-Co-Ordinator (based in Broome) and Campus Services Team (based in Broome and Fremantle) to effectively manage the Kununurra operation for Majarlin as a Kimberley-wide Department.

Key Responsibilities

Majarlin Administration Support:

  • General office duties such as maintaining office supplies, running errands, facilitating team meetings and planning events.
  • Provide financial support to the Administration Coordinator by following existing finance and procurement policies to process payments, create purchase orders, and balance credit cards.
  • Monitor expenditure against the budget and maintain an accurate database of payments.
  • Work accurately with detailed information; including data entry, maintaining spreadsheets, managing correspondence, collating data for report and under direction prepare a range of written communication.
  • Vehicle management including overseeing usage bookings, regular servicing and completing insurance claims.

Campus Services Support:

  • Work with the Campus Services team and Student Placement Coordinators to manage Kununurra accommodation bookings.
  • Liaise with and schedule contractors such as cleaners, gardeners, and maintenance.
  • Oversee the purchasing of essential accommodation supplies.
  • Provide customer service to students and stakeholders, ensuring timely communication when responding to queries regarding placements.
  • Ensure the dissemination of specific and accurate advice while maintaining confidentiality, integrity, and compliance.

Majarlin Student Support:

  • Assist students upon arrival to Kununurra and guide them through check in and check out procedures including occasional airport transfers.
  • Arrange travel for students attending outreach trips and visiting staff.
  • Build effective relationships with students, staff, and placement facilities by providing professional service and resolution of issues regarding placements.
  • Liaise with learning institutions in the development of partnerships for the placement of students including maintaining a database of placement sites/agencies and the student information database.
  • Collate and analyse data relating to student results, evaluations of supervisor performance and feedback for reports.
  • Contribute to the improvement of service delivery that will ensure a streamlined student placement process.
  • In collaboration with the Cultural Security officer and Student Placement Coordinator, organise orientation sessions for students.
Qualifications, skills & experience
  • Completion of a degree without subsequent relevant work experience, or completion of an advanced diploma qualification and at least 1 years subsequent relevant work experience, or completion of a diploma qualification and at least 2 years subsequent relevant work experience, or completion of a Certificate IV and extensive relevant work experience or an equivalent combination of relevant experience and/or education/training.
  • Experience in educational administration and/or student coordination or experience in similar environment (desirable).
  • Demonstrated ability to work under pressure to meet tight deadlines using effective time management, and planning skills.
  • Preparation of high-quality documentation, including accurate presentations, reports, and promotional materials.
  • Excellent operational, organisational and administration skills including the ability to manage multiple competing priorities.
  • Highly developed communication skills, with the ability to build relationships and engage with local contractors and external stakeholders.
  • High level of competency across the Microsoft Office Suite and the ability to quickly pick up new facilities management, finance, and general database systems.
